Редактирование списка EIP ...

Clarion, Clarion 7

Модератор: Дед Пахом

Правила форума
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
Ответить
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 8020
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 28 раз
Поблагодарили: 94 раза

Редактирование списка EIP ...

Сообщение Игорь Столяров »

Привет всем !

Что-то я совсем запутался. Вроде бы где-то, когда-то и кому-то делал, а сейчас долблюсь и не могу вспомнить ... :(

Clarion 6.3 9059 ABC

Есть элементраный список. В нем записи и их редактирование EIP.
Кроме разумных данных, в строке есть дата и время последнего изменения (недоступны для редактирования EIP).
Вопрос: В какое место Embed нужно вставить присвоение полям записи текщей даты и времени после того как
пользователь введет данные и нажмет ENTER (или сохранит запись переходом на другую строку и т.д.) ?!

Простите если туплю (а похоже на то) и заранее спасибо за подсказку ... :)
Make Clarion Great Again ! 😎
БАИ
Посетитель
Сообщения: 25
Зарегистрирован: 09 Октябрь 2009, 13:05

Re: Редактирование списка EIP ...

Сообщение БАИ »

BRW1::EIPManager.TakeAcceptAll PROCEDURE ?
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 8020
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 28 раз
Поблагодарили: 94 раза

Re: Редактирование списка EIP ...

Сообщение Игорь Столяров »

БАИ писал(а):BRW1::EIPManager.TakeAcceptAll PROCEDURE ?
Это не работает. Нашел тот код в котором работает ...

BRW1::EIPManager.TakeCompleted PROCEDURE(BYTE Force)

CODE
! Start of "Browse EIP Manager Method Executable Code Section"
! [Priority 2500]
! ---- В этом месте пишем необходимые изменения QUEUE (!!!) редактируемого списка ---
Queue:Browse:1.ATP:DateEdit = Today()
Queue:Browse:1.ATP:TimeEdit = Clock()
! ------------------------------------------------------------------------------------------------------------
! Parent Call
PARENT.TakeCompleted(Force)
...
Make Clarion Great Again ! 😎
Ответить